had a beach hunt today , found a coin patch with a florin , penny and about 24 one and two cents, just wondering if there is a reason why there were so many copper coins together.
 
I come across this a lot many people including myself lay 1 and 2 c coins to see if the area is being detected by anyone else, and in some areas i thinks people have just thrown them away very often i get 20 to 30 in one spot
 
I got two spots in the park where I'm detecting like that. I just give it miss now, I got three and half kilos of 1 and 2 cents in the garage and don't want any more.
Karl
 
Had the same with 5c coins, about 15 from an area about 3x3m one day. I think at times the tidal action tends to group or sort similar coins in the same locality, a lot of these lighter coins tend to get flicked up to the top of the beach.
